    Comments Thread For: William Zepeda and Tevin Farmer make weight for rematch

    William Zepeda is set to rematch Tevin Farmer after the two made weight for their 12-round lightweight main event, which headlines a Golden Boy Promotions card tomorrow night at Poliforum Benito Juarez in Cancun, Mexico.
